This marks the beginning of many years of research on the modern glaciation of the Svalbard archipelago: in total he took part in six expeditions to Svalbard (1882, 1896, 1899, 1901, 1908 and 1910). Gerard de Geer remained a lecturer at the Department of Geology at the University of Stockholm from 1897 to 1924. At the university, he served as rector (1902-1910) and vice-chancellor from (1911-1924). In addition, De Geer was a member of the Swedish Parliament from 1900 to 1905. The pinnacle of de Geer's scientific career can be considered the receipt of the presidency of the X International Geological Congress, held in Stockholm in 1910. At first he took part in the preparation of the Congress as vice-chairman of the preparatory committee, and from May 1907 - as chairman of the executive committee. Within the framework of the congress, he delivered the now classic lecture "A geochronology of the last 12000 years". However, by the mid-1930s De Geer's teleconnections had become the subject of increasing criticism from his former student Ernst Antevs. Antevs correctly argued that the teleconnections were bad science, and that De Geer's Trans-Atlantic correlations were inaccurate. De Geer felt his position was being caricatured and intentionally misunderstood by Antevs, but did little scientifically to rebuff the criticisms levelled at him. Geochronologia Suecica Principles

In 1940, De Geer published his longest and best-known work ''Geochronologia Suecica Principles'', in which he presented part of the Swedish Time Scale in detail, and expounded upon his theories and work regarding varves. Almost immediately after the publication of ''Geochronologia Suecica Principles'' De Geer's Swedish Time Scale underwent the first of many revisions, as other geologists became involved in the study of varves and more sites were examined. De Geer from a modern perspective

De Geer's most significant contribution to Quaternary science was unquestionably the identification of varves, and his recognition of their potential in establishing annual chronologies of past climatic and environmental change. The Swedish Time Scale was the most precise and accurate geological timescale of its day, and it is still being improved and added to today. His insistence that varves represented quantifiable proxies for past climate has since been borne out to a degree, but the relationship between varve thickness and hydrometeorological conditions is not as simple as he presumed. Varves have recently experienced a renaissance as methods and techniques of study have improved, and varves are now regularly used to calibrate radiocarbon timescales. In many ways, De Geer's concerns mirror that of modern Quaternary geologists and palaeoclimatologists, particularly his recognition of the need for high-resolution natural archives of past change, and the importance of testing whether global change is synchronous. De Geer's principle failing was his faith in teleconnections, where his findings were clearly influenced by his preconceptions. His belief that variations in solar radiation were the principal agent of all climate change has also since been shown to be incorrect. Nevertheless, De Geer asked all the right questions, and his errors can be attributed as much to over-enthusiasm and a single-minded passion, as they can to bad science.
